Choose Contemporary Rugs That Can Add Charm And Dazzle
Posted on August 20th, 2010 No commentsAdding an area rug to any design is a great way to give the room a boost of life. Contemporary styled area rugs are the new “it” these days so why not join the crowd?
Bold patterns, colors, and washable materials in the contemporary area rugs are a great way to bring the design into any home without having to fear that it will just be more of a hassle.
Choosing a new Contemporary rug is just like selecting any other rug. The guidelines are still:
What’s the rug’s use – traffic, focal point, accessory? How big is the room? How will it spark or complement the decor?
Beyond that, choosing a Contemporary rug for any living area is purely a matter of taste. Whatever the color or pattern, you the buyer get the fun of choosing the area rug that appeals most to you.
Contemporary area rugs for specific rooms of the home:
Living Room:
If it is a smaller room try going for something on the smaller side with a brighter color palette. You don’t want the room to be overwhelmed with a large patterned area rug.
In a larger room you have the option for a larger pattern or even a larger rug. Another way you could take this is smaller rugs dispersed throughout the room creating a break in each area.
Bolder and Simpler:
Brighten a dark room with an area rug in sunny, warm tones.
Bright designs such as abstract will help set the tone for contemporary furniture pieces.
Bordered area rugs are great in family rooms placed underneath the coffee table to set off the conversation area.
Dining Room:
Since the rug most likely will be under the dining table, look for rug patterns with the emphasis on the borders, not the center. Why waste a magnificent Persian in a medallion style in a spot where it won’t be seen during the main activity?
Children’s Rooms:
When choosing the right area rug for a child’s room you’ll want to make sure they are durable, stain resistant, and easy to clean.
Avoid rugs made in the patterns of popular cartoon characters to keep the child’s room from becoming dated (and the child begging for another rug with the latest favorite). Instead choose a pattern with colors that will match a favorite of styles as the child matures and his/her tastes change. Or choose a braided rug in multiple bright colors.
If you have a large enough bedroom try choosing a game area rug for the play area such as a race track and then a basic colored area rug for the other side of the bed by the night stand.
If the area is too small for two rugs at once then go for something which can cover most of the room but then also be a learning tool. Many are sold with the numbers, alphabet, or even color scheme to give your child a learning toy and also decorating their room.
Contemporary rugs come in many different shapes, sizes, and patters so there is always something for someone out there no matter your design.

Using Contemporary Area Rugs To Decorate A Home
Posted on November 19th, 2008 No commentsDecorating a room is an essential part of creating a warm homely atmosphere that one loves to live in. Area rugs offer a versatile way of changing a room in short time. Since only one element, the area rug, of the room has to be changed it is also a cost efficient way of redecorating a room.
Styles and Colors
You can find any color or style of contemporary rug that you need to decorate your home quickly and easily. Perhaps the most popular style of contemporary rugs available is the Oriental style, which features designs of flowers.
These contemporary rugs fit in well with any dcor, even the most simple or complex designs. Contemporary rugs can also feature specialized designs, such as sailboats or castles that work well in kid’s rooms or family rooms.
Patterns
The pattern on your contemporary rugs is also an important part of choosing a rug for decorating your home. A rug with a bold pattern is great when you want to liven a room, while a simple pattern of muted colors is good when you simply need to warm the look of a room without taking away from the decor.
Tips for Decorating
A large contemporary rug is a good idea for a room that has a simple design, and needs some warmth and color added. One rug can change the atmosphere of your room, bringing out the colors in your home or by adding some spice to an otherwise dull room.
The aspects of a room can be easily controlled by placing one contemporary area rugs in the room to highlight part of the room’s decor. A brighter than the room colors area rug could for instance brighten the room quite a bit.
Buyers of a contemporary area rug that want to place it on hardwood floors or other slippery floors should always purchase some non-slip rug mats as well so that the rugs will stay firm in place on the floor.
Whimsical Contemporary Rugs
Themed contemporary area rugs can be placed into almost any room but they certainly make most sense in the kitchen, children’s rooms or wash rooms. An area rug in a kitchen could for instance be foot themed while on in a wash room could sport an aquatic theme instead.
Contemporary area rugs should always be chosen to complement or brighten a room in the house or apartment. This ensures that the home will feel lively, inviting and interesting to anyone living it it or visiting.
